Phone number βοΈ 01877550056 π is reported as a scam call often using an Indian accent and pretending to be from major UK networks like EE, O2 or Three. Callers typically try to offer discounts or discuss contracts but ask for personal info such as passwords or bank details, then either hang up or get aggressive when challenged. Many users found the calls confusing due to unclear speech and background noise, sometimes just silent with beeps before hanging up. The number is frequently blocked and ignored by users, with warnings to be cautious as these are likely fraudulent calls using VoIP to spoof UK numbers. Overall, itβs strongly associated with phishing attempts and unsolicited spam calls.

About 01 Numbers
The indicated numbers refer to specific locations in the UK and are typically used by homes and businesses. Often called as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the charges for these geographic numbers are based on the time of day. Most service providers offer call packages that grant free calls during designated times. Call costs from mobile phones are according to the chosen calling plan, with several plans containing these numbers in their free call packages.
